Just got my copy of Catherine yesterday. Ran around my house in the boxers and platformed around my house and nearby surroundings. Shit was like parkour. Anyways, after having a bit of fun with the goodies that came with the game, it was time to actually play the game.

It's really enjoyable, I'm so far in the middle of the Clock Tower (Floor 6). Story is good as expected. Talking to bar customers plays out sort of like Social Links in Persona somewhat, only a lot less complex- you still do have to plan out how you talk to them because of different times of when people enter and leave the bar, but the dialogues are way simpler and shorter and obviously being able to cover everyone over the night as the key difference. And of course, the puzzle gameplay is amazing.

I've been playing on Normal mode so far. So far, pretty challenging, but doable. I'm curious why the original Japanese release was so hard, though. Maybe I'll look that up some time.
